Transaction 2589ca363975f6bcf7213f1c7bf228c40cbc65e3c1f75bb9f01de591f05d27c3
1 Input
1 Output
-
2589ca363975f6bcf7213f1c7bf228c40cbc65e3c1f75bb9f01de591f05d27c3:0
- value
- 267124
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ceaf0cd834bd152b5c5717e8fb01c01de716c65 OP_EQUAL
- address
- 34KvHso1vx86UgfdjxKXRxhKdAvrndeDFM